随着互联网的快速发展,短信验证码作为一种常见的身份验证方式,在各大网站和APP中得到了广泛应用。然而,随之而来的是恶意攻击者利用短信验证码进行非法行为的风险。如何应对这些恶意攻击,保障短信验证码平台的安全稳定运行,成为了亟待解决的问题。本文将从以下几个方面探讨如何应对恶意攻击。

一、恶意攻击的类型及危害

  1. 恶意攻击的类型

(1)短信验证码轰炸:攻击者利用大量手机号码发送验证码,短时间内对目标平台进行高频次攻击,导致平台服务瘫痪。

(2)验证码破解:攻击者通过技术手段破解验证码,获取用户账户信息,进而进行非法操作。

(3)验证码倒卖:攻击者通过非法渠道获取验证码,然后倒卖给他人,用于注册虚假账号、刷单等非法行为。


  1. 恶意攻击的危害

(1)用户账户安全受到威胁:恶意攻击可能导致用户账户信息泄露,进而引发财产损失、隐私泄露等问题。

(2)平台声誉受损:恶意攻击事件频发,将严重影响平台的信誉和用户信任度。

(3)运营成本增加:平台需要投入大量人力、物力应对恶意攻击,导致运营成本增加。

二、应对恶意攻击的策略

  1. 优化验证码生成算法

(1)提高验证码复杂度:增加验证码字符数量、随机性,降低攻击者破解的可能性。

(2)采用动态验证码:根据用户行为、IP地址等信息动态生成验证码,提高攻击者破解难度。


  1. 限制验证码发送频率

(1)设置验证码发送间隔:限制用户在一定时间内只能发送一定数量的验证码,降低攻击者攻击成功率。

(2)识别异常行为:对短时间内发送大量验证码的用户进行监控,发现异常行为及时采取措施。


  1. 加强用户账户安全防护

(1)设置账户登录保护:采用双因素认证、手机验证等多种方式,提高账户安全性。

(2)加强账户信息审核:对用户注册信息进行严格审核,防止虚假账号注册。


  1. 提高平台安全防护能力

(1)加强服务器安全防护:采用防火墙、入侵检测系统等手段,防止恶意攻击。

(2)数据加密:对用户数据进行加密存储,防止数据泄露。


  1. 加强与第三方合作

(1)与运营商合作:获取实时用户行为数据,协助识别恶意攻击。

(2)与安全厂商合作:引进先进的安全技术,提高平台安全防护能力。

三、总结

短信验证码平台在应对恶意攻击方面,需要从多个角度出发,采取综合措施。通过优化验证码生成算法、限制验证码发送频率、加强用户账户安全防护、提高平台安全防护能力以及加强与第三方合作,可以有效降低恶意攻击风险,保障平台的安全稳定运行。同时,也需要不断提高自身的安全防护能力,应对不断变化的网络安全威胁。